Welcome to the Climate–Ocean–Lake Dynamics (COLD) Lab at Illinois State University. We investigate the physical processes governing oceans, lakes, and the climate system by integrating satellite remote sensing, in situ observations, reanalysis products, and high-resolution numerical models. Our research focuses on aquatic dynamics, air–water interactions, carbon cycling, regional and global climate, and nature-based climate solutions, with the goal of improving understanding and prediction of a changing Earth system.
